Qiang Yang is a Ph.D. student in Computer Science program at Machine Intelligence and kNowledge Engineering (MINE) Laboratory under the supervision of Professor Xiangliang Zhang at King Abdullah University of Science and Technology (KAUST). Research Interests Qiang's research interests include Knowledge Graph Mining. Selected Publications Zhixu Li, Qiang Yang, An Liu, Guanfeng Liu, Lei Zhao, Xiangliang Zhang and Xiaofang Zhou.
